What are SBTS?

SBTS can refer to 'Southern Baptist Theological Seminary,' a prominent institution for theological education and ministerial training in the United States. The seminary offers various graduate and doctoral programs focused on Christian theology, biblical studies, and ministry leadership. It is known for its commitment to conservative evangelical doctrine and preparing students for service in churches and related ministries. Admission typically requires a bachelor's degree and a statement of Christian faith. The seminary is located in Louisville, Kentucky.

Job description

JOB SUMMARY:

The purpose of this position is to provide knowledgeable and friendly customer service and to answer mailing questions.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:

The employee in this position will have the following essential job functions:

  • Politely greet all customers with a smile
  • Assist patrons with package pickup
  • Answer questions related to mailing services
  • Thorough understanding of the Domestics and International Mailing Manuals, UPS rates and regulations, USPS forms, and SBTS policies and procedures
  • Sort and post incoming external and interoffice mail effectively and efficiently
  • Prepare mail and other shipping items for all carriers
  • Track postage due and metered postage
  • Process package notice for express, insured, certified delivery confirmation, etc.
  • Meter outgoing mail
  • Perform courier services
  • Assist in processing bulk mail
  • Maintain organized and professional appearance in all areas at all times

Performs other duties as may be assigned by supervisor.

EDUCATION:

It is required/preferred that the person in this position has received a high school diploma.

EXPERIENCE:

It is required/preferred that the person in this position have experience that demonstrates an ability to interact with customers and efficiently process tasks.

SUPERVISION:

The person in this position will supervise no one.

The person in this position will report to Mailing Services Specialist.

WORK ENVIRONMENT:

The person in this position will work in a noisy environment, standing, sitting, bending and stretching, lifting and repetitive movements. Must be required to lift more than 60 pounds and have a valid US Driver's license.
